160960688 has 30 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 362779236. Its totient is φ = 68982816.
The previous prime is 160960687. The next prime is 160960691. The reversal of 160960688 is 886069061.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(160960687)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 5 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 101870 + ... + 103437.
Almost surely, 2160960688 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
160960688 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(201818548).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
160960688 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
160960688 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 205329 (or 205316 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 124416, while the sum is 44.
The square root of 160960688 is about 12687.0283360604. The cubic root of 160960688 is about 543.9679010760.
